“Keith and I met in Nashville, TN. He lived there while I visiting from Michigan. After bumping into him downtown a few times and seeing a little chemistry between us, I got his phone number but never had a chance to call him while in Nashville. Two weeks later, and back in Michigan, I was still thinking and talking about him so I decided to give him a call. It turned out that sometime in those 2 weeks Keith joined the United States Marine Corps and was leaving for Boot Camp in 8 days. We spent those 8 days talking on the phone and the next 3 months writing letters to get to know each other.  After brief visits with each other during his training, we knew things were serious and I moved down south to be with him.”

 

“Our second Christmas together we were in Nashville walking through the Opry Land Hotel. Santa was there and Keith insisted we go tell Santa what we wanted for Christmas. I was hesitant but went along with the idea. While on Santa’s lap, he asked us both if we had been good this year. We both said "of course!” Santa then asked me what I wanted for Christmas and I told him “nothing really” while in the back of my head all I wanted was to get engaged to Keith.  Santa then turned to Keith and asked him what he wanted for Christmas; it was then it happened. Keith got down on his knee and said there were some things he hoped to receive for Christmas but the thing he wanted most was for us to spend the rest of our lives together.”

 

 

“We chose the Castle because it was different from any other weddings we had been to. We wanted something that we and our guests would always remember as unique and gorgeous. Between our ideas and the Castle staff’s organization, we accomplished just that! To this day we still have people complimenting us on what a beautiful event our wedding was.”

 

“By having our reception in the King’s EastGarden, we were able to open the French doors, let some fresh air in and allow our guests to walk around to enjoy the majestic nature the Castle offers.”

“We chose black and turquoise for our colors and accented with gerbera daisy bouquets. For a personal touch we placed a different picture of us together on each table along with mini-biographies describing our lives leading up to finding each other.”

 

“We were living in Georgia during the planning stages so even though we were unable to visit the Castle as often as we would have liked, everything ran smoothly.  Maggie and Anora were extremely efficient contacting us via email or phone to answer questions and keep us informed of our options, deadlines and payments.”
